Making money online sounds like a dream to many of us. But the four apps we're going to show you today promise exactly that. The principle behind it is simple. You complete tasks and are rewarded for them. So just like a normal job. Many of these apps follow the motto "small livestock also makes crap". So you get about four to five euros for a task. We have tested all apps on Android and give you our report.

Streetspotr

In the Streetspotr app, you can play Touri in your own city. The registration takes a bit, but once you're done with it, you can accept orders. In our first assignment, we were asked to come to Kantstrasse to check the presence of a technology brand in a computer shop. This includes things like photographing the store from the outside and inside, but also writing reports on what the tech department looks like in the store.

How often is the brand is shown, which other providers stand next to it and maybe look better? Or how many of the devices on display are actually connected to electricity? These are typical questions that are listed and require an answer. For each job, there are instructions on how you should behave because you are theoretically working on behalf of a company. There is also the possibility to unlock even more contracts for "adults". All you have to do is take a picture of your ID and send it to support.

At first glance, everything seems serious and reliable here. The order that we fulfilled was also accepted and processed by the team. We can therefore recommend the Streetspotr app to you.

ShopScout

The idea behind ShopScout is to earn money while you shop. What can easily be done as a hobby in America with coupons, we have to compensate for here in Germany with hard extra work. Registration is super quick and hassle-free via Facebook. ShopScout looks very clear. So you will quickly find your way around the task area. What you should be aware of is that not all orders bring in guaranteed money, but are sometimes held as competitions, e.g. "Photograph your favorite ice cream flavor - the most beautiful photo wins".

Taking product photos in local shops is also part of it. In the past, ShopScout has often had very negative reviews due to technical difficulties that have emptied users' order lists. Affected users could not claim their money and work more or less for nothing. But that didn't happen to us. However, we advise you not to put too much work into the app before cashing out.

AppJobber

The appJobber app is great for getting an approximate overview of how the jobs will come to you. Here you only have to register if you want to accept a task. Before that, you can look around the offer. With appJobber you can not only complete jobs on the go, but also take part in surveys and test other apps from home. In our case, we downloaded an app from a major data company, entered our details there, and took screenshots to confirm.

After the app had been installed for a few days, we received the confirmation email we needed to complete the order. This may seem very draining at first and you won't see results right away. In return, you have the luxury of not having to constantly rush from one end of the city to the other.

With a feature called “Job Alerts”, you still get the traditional “Go here and do that” jobs.

Roamler

In our opinion, Roamler is the coolest app of them all. There is a level system within the app that unlocks more jobs over time, which also pays better. However, you start at level one and have to fight your way up with some tutorial tasks in order to unlock real paid jobs. For example, you will be shown pictures of shelves and you have to indicate which one was photographed best and meets all the criteria. Roamler is the only app in our test that offers this type of instruction.

Actually, you can only use Roamler if you have an invite code. If there are still free user places in your region, you can simply register like this. You don't feel like you're in a purely commercial environment here, instead, you have that little mini-game factor included. Congratulations - test winner. Incidentally, Roamler is also the only app that we will continue to use hereafter. It is so unique in that it doesn't just let the user do work, but offers a real job on the side.
